WASHINGTON - The Virginia Supreme Court on Friday struck down a voter‑approved Democratic congressional redistricting plan, delivering a major setback to the party in a nationwide fight with Republicans for an edge in this year’s midterm elections. What we know: The court ruled that the Democratic‑led General Assembly violated required procedures when it placed a constitutional amendment on the ballot to authorize mid‑decade redistricting. Voters narrowly approved the amendment on April 21, but the ruling voids the results. "This violation irreparably undermines the integrity of the resulting referendum vote and renders it null and void," the court wrote.

Republican Sen. Mitt Romney of Utah announced Wednesday he will not run for reelection to a second term in the Senate in 2024. "I spent my last 25 years in public service of one kind or another," Romney said in a video posted on social media. "At the end of another term, I'd be in my mid-80s. Frankly, it's time for a new generation of leaders." Romney, 76, was the Republican nominee for president in 2012 and won election to the Senate in 2018. "While I'm not running for reelection, I'm not retiring from the fight," he said. "I'll be your United States senator until January of 2025."

A three-judge panel overseeing a recount in a close Virginia state House race upheld the Republican candidate’s victory on Friday, a decision that also reaffirms the GOP’s takeover of the chamber and completes the party’s sweep of last month’s elections. Republicans also claimed the statewide offices of governor, lieutenant governor and attorney general in the Nov. 2 balloting. Those wins were a dramatic turnaround in a state where the GOP had not won a statewide race since 2009. Democrats still hold a 21-19 majority in the Senate— where elections won’t be held until 2023

The US Centers for Disease Control and Prevention has classified the hantavirus outbreak as a “Level 3” threat and activated its Emergency Operations Centers, sources told ABC News Thursday. The designation is the lowest level of emergency activation, signifying that the risk to the general public remains low — in line with information given by the World Health Organization earlier Thursday The CDC is actively monitoring the situation, including by activating the Emergency Operations Centers. This typically signals that a designated emergency team has been set up to handle hantavirus, the outlet reported. Epidemiologists, scientists, and physicians may be reassigned to monitor and assist with the disease response.
